Troy Recreation to host 10th basketball camp

Published 3:00 am Saturday, June 16, 2018

The Troy Recreation Center will host the 10th annual Summer Basketball Camp next month.

Charles Henderson Middle School head coach and Camp Director Justin Cope will lead the camp that normally has about 100 participants. The camp will run from July 23 until July 27.

“I am very excited every year for this camp,” Cope said. “I get asked year-round when this camp will be. The kids are excited and the parents are excited. This is good for the kids because they learn about things other than basketball, but it’s a good way for kids to develop in basketball.”
The excitement of the youth is one of the things that has drawn Cope to continue the camp for the last 10 years.

“It’s a great feeling,” Cope said. “It lets me know that the camp is benefiting the community and the kids.”

When Cope started the camp, he didn’t expect the camp to still be running 10 years later.

“When I started it 10 years ago, a parent put it in my mind that I should start a camp,” Cope said. “Every year it just grows and grows. One year we had 101 kids and it grows from there.”

Cope didn’t confirm that he has something special officially planned for the 10-year anniversary, but it is something he is thinking about.

“We are going to try and surprise the kids with something,” Cope said. “I am trying to think of some ideas and we have had some parents throw some ideas at me. We will do drills and have some speakers talk with the kids.”

Registration for the camp will began June 14 at the Troy Recreation Center. The camp will cost $30 per child and it will run from 8 a.m. until Noon.
